2. Expanding networks and looking outwards
Today's engineers must also be able to broaden the scope of innovation, moving away from the idea that a breakthrough innovation is only a technological innovation. They must know how to evolve their work processes and tools to be more attuned to uses, product-related services, new business models and evolving technologies. It's in this broader field that you'll find the right idea to create value.
Thinking about innovation today also means thinking in terms of innovative organization. Involve all the company's functions and its innovation partners, right from the start of the cycle, by thinking in terms of uses and customer experiences, and by developing a culture of innovation and clear incentives and rewards for changing and challenging your habits every day.
